rep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
added more #elif tests
2002-01-26
bella
r
d
added more
#e
l
i
f
t
ests
commit
|
commitdiff
|
tree
2002-01-26
b
ellard
stdcall added +
floating point
f
ixes
commit
|
commitdiff
|
tree
2002-01-13
bellard
f
ixed -D option
commit
|
commitdiff
|
tree
2002-01-12
bellard
win
3
2 defines +
n
ew
inter
n
a
l file l
a
yer
commit
|
commitdiff
|
tree
2002-01-05
bellard
a
d
ded a
n
si p
r
oto
commit
|
commitdiff
|
tree
2002-01-05
bellard
add
c
99 macros
commit
|
commitdiff
|
tree
2002-01-05
b
el
l
ard
a
d
ded bound t
e
st
commit
|
commitdiff
|
tree
2002-01-05
bellard
f
ixed gl
i
bc bug
commit
|
commitdiff
|
tree
2002-01-05
bellard
implic
i
t c
a
s
t
in
g
loba
l
init
- a
d
d
e
d
b
ound check define
.
.
.
commit
|
commitdiff
|
tree
2002-01-05
bel
l
ard
comments
commit
|
commitdiff
|
tree
2002-01-05
bel
l
ard
update
commit
|
commitdiff
|
tree
2002-01-05
bella
r
d
f
ixe
d
me
m
set
commit
|
commitdiff
|
tree
2002-01-05
bellard
be
t
t
e
r
erro
r
dis
p
la
y
-
a
dded some strin
g
functi
o
ns
commit
|
commitdiff
|
tree
2002-01-05
b
ellard
b
o
unding tests
commit
|
commitdiff
|
tree
2002-01-05
bellard
c
h
ange
d
tcc tests
n
ame
commit
|
commitdiff
|
tree
2002-01-05
bellard
better
run tim
e
error
display
commit
|
commitdiff
|
tree
2002-01-05
bell
a
rd
added local bound generation
-
f
i
xed binary ops - ad
d
e
d
.
.
.
commit
|
commitdiff
|
tree
2002-01-05
bellard
added local bound
g
eneration
commit
|
commitdiff
|
tree
2002-01-05
b
ellard
finished bou
n
d che
c
k
c
o
d
e
(st
i
ll s
l
ow
)
- fi
x
ed b
i
nary
.
.
.
commit
|
commitdiff
|
tree
2002-01-05
bellard
use mal
l
oc ho
o
k
s to properly c
a
t
ch all mallocs
commit
|
commitdiff
|
tree
2002-01-05
bellard
fixed VT_LLOC
A
L de
r
eferencing
commit
|
commitdiff
|
tree
2002-01-04
bel
l
ard
added
m
i
nimal d
e
bug info support
commit
|
commitdiff
|
tree
2002-01-03
bellard
first version of boun
d
s che
c
ke
r
commit
|
commitdiff
|
tree
2002-01-03
bellar
d
suppressed some buffer overflow
s
- m
o
ved fun
c
ti
o
n gen
e
ration
.
.
.
commit
|
commitdiff
|
tree
2002-01-03
bellard
0 constant ca
n
be used a
s
a
pointer
commit
|
commitdiff
|
tree
2002-01-03
b
e
l
l
ard
added full long long suppo
r
t
- added secti
o
n support
.
.
.
commit
|
commitdiff
|
tree
2001-12-23
b
e
llard
u
se register classes (will
a
l
low better
a
nd
sim
p
ler
.
.
.
commit
|
commitdiff
|
tree
2001-12-22
b
ellard
last patches to separate type and value
handling
commit
|
commitdiff
|
tree
2001-12-20
bella
r
d
s
e
pa
r
ated typ
e
a
n
d
v
al
u
e on
stack
commit
|
commitdiff
|
tree
2001-12-19
b
ella
r
d
error() fixes
commit
|
commitdiff
|
tree
2001-12-17
bellard
upda
t
e
commit
|
commitdiff
|
tree
2001-12-17
bellard
float upd
a
te
commit
|
commitdiff
|
tree
2001-12-16
bellard
tcc
d
ocumentatio
n
commit
|
commitdiff
|
tree
2001-12-16
bell
a
r
d
new valu
e
stack sy
s
tem to
h
andle
t
he f
u
t
u
r
types (lon
g
.
.
.
commit
|
commitdiff
|
tree
2001-12-13
bellar
d
adde
d
float
.
h
s
t
d
heade
r
commit
|
commitdiff
|
tree
2001-12-13
bella
r
d
fix
e
d macro
b
ug and du
m
my float
c
ons
t
ant parsing
commit
|
commitdiff
|
tree
2001-12-13
b
e
ll
a
rd
float parsing + long double
commit
|
commitdiff
|
tree
2001-12-12
bell
a
rd
separ
a
ted
i
3
86 code generator
commit
|
commitdiff
|
tree
2001-12-12
bella
r
d
began to integrate
floating
p
oin
t
n
umbers -
s
eparat
e
d
.
.
.
commit
|
commitdiff
|
tree
2001-12-09
be
l
lar
d
added bit
f
ield
s
supp
o
rt
commit
|
commitdiff
|
tree
2001-12-09
bellard
f
i
xed switc
h
-
p
r
e
paration for new types
commit
|
commitdiff
|
tree
2001-12-08
b
e
llard
better type sto
r
age
commit
|
commitdiff
|
tree
2001-12-08
bellard
fi
x
function call and ! opera
t
o
r
commit
|
commitdiff
|
tree
2001-12-08
b
e
llard
added multipl
e
fi
l
es compile - vari
o
us symbo
l
r
e
lated
.
.
.
commit
|
commitdiff
|
tree
2001-12-06
bellard
even faster
commit
|
commitdiff
|
tree
2001-12-06
b
ellard
use faster I
/
O
fu
n
c
t
ion
s
- static comp
i
le patches
commit
|
commitdiff
|
tree
2001-12-05
bellard
better t
y
pe checks - syntax fix
e
s
(gnu_ext ad
d
e
d
)
.
.
.
commit
|
commitdiff
|
tree
2001-12-05
bellard
bette
r
e
x
te
r
nal allocs handling
commit
|
commitdiff
|
tree
2001-12-02
bellard
versi
o
n
change
commit
|
commitdiff
|
tree
2001-12-02
bella
r
d
update
commit
|
commitdiff
|
tree
2001-12-02
bellard
added structure assi
g
nment (for = an
d
functi
o
n cal
l
s
.
.
.
commit
|
commitdiff
|
tree
2001-12-02
bellard
first sta
g
e for struct
u
r
e assig
n
-
added more generic
.
.
.
commit
|
commitdiff
|
tree
2001-12-02
bellard
a
d
d
ed
K
&R pro
t
o parsing
commit
|
commitdiff
|
tree
2001-12-02
bellard
added compound literals parsing - fixed string
i
n
it
.
.
.
commit
|
commitdiff
|
tree
2001-11-28
bellard
added
wide cha
r
and
strin
g
parsi
n
g - added zero init
.
.
.
commit
|
commitdiff
|
tree
2001-11-26
bellard
compl
e
ted
initializer handlign (c
o
m
pute size before
.
.
.
commit
|
commitdiff
|
tree
2001-11-18
bellard
updat
e
commit
|
commitdiff
|
tree
2001-11-18
bellard
added hash t
a
bles - ad
d
-
o opti
o
n for debug
output
commit
|
commitdiff
|
tree
2001-11-17
b
e
llard
fixed \nnn char p
a
r
s
i
n
g, add
e
d #l
i
ne,
a
dded
__V
A
_ARG
S
_
_
.
.
.
commit
|
commitdiff
|
tree
2001-11-13
bellard
ISOC99 r
e
strict,__fun
c
_
_
- added misc macros
commit
|
commitdiff
|
tree
2001-11-11
bellard
upda
t
e
commit
|
commitdiff
|
tree
2001-11-11
bellard
update
commit
|
commitdiff
|
tree
2001-11-11
bellard
eval function ar
g
s
in r
e
verse order
-
added short an
d
.
.
.
commit
|
commitdiff
|
tree
2001-11-11
bel
l
a
r
d
bet
t
er type decl - added -l
a
nd
-
D options - added
.
.
.
commit
|
commitdiff
|
tree
2001-11-11
bellard
add
e
d st
d
libs
commit
|
commitdiff
|
tree
2001-11-11
bellard
new prepr
o
cessi
n
g: macro f
u
nction handling
a
nd
better
.
.
.
commit
|
commitdiff
|
tree
2001-11-08
bellard
suppress
e
d an
o
ther alloc
commit
|
commitdiff
|
tree
2001-11-08
bell
a
rd
f
i
x
de
f
i
n
ed() handling
commit
|
commitdiff
|
tree
2001-11-08
bellard
add
e
d #if su
p
por
t
commit
|
commitdiff
|
tree
2001-11-07
b
e
l
lard
added function
pr
o
toty
p
es and correc
t
recurs
i
ve type
.
.
.
commit
|
commitdiff
|
tree
2001-11-06
bellard
tcclib sample
commit
|
commitdiff
|
tree
2001-11-06
bellard
n
ew code generator wi
t
h
constant prop
a
gatio
n
and register
.
.
.
commit
|
commitdiff
|
tree
2001-11-01
b
e
llard
added u
n
ion/struct
+ correct loca
l
symbols
commit
|
commitdiff
|
tree
2001-10-30
b
e
l
lard
added enum
,
ty
p
edefs, goto, switch
commit
|
commitdiff
|
tree
2001-10-30
bellard
ad
d
ed do w
h
i
le con
t
i
n
ue - si
m
p
l
ify
b
re
a
k/con
t
i
nue han
d
lin
g
commit
|
commitdiff
|
tree
2001-10-29
bel
l
ar
d
clarif
i
ed functi
o
n typ
e
s
- added extern / sta
t
ic
-
.
.
.
commit
|
commitdiff
|
tree
2001-10-28
bellard
added 'x'= operators
commit
|
commitdiff
|
tree
2001-10-28
bell
a
rd
u
pdated
commit
|
commitdiff
|
tree
2001-10-28
bella
r
d
update for nam
e
change
commit
|
commitdiff
|
tree
2001-10-28
b
ellard
added comment
s
+ correct er
r
or repo
r
ting
commit
|
commitdiff
|
tree
2001-10-28
b
e
llard
remove
u
nused
f
eatures for TINY
mode
commit
|
commitdiff
|
tree
2001-10-28
b
e
l
lard
a
d
de
d
f
or, con
d
and comma suppo
r
t -
fixed div/mod code
commit
|
commitdiff
|
tree
2001-10-28
bellard
shl and
shr and for tiny mo
d
e only
commit
|
commitdiff
|
tree
2001-10-27
bellard
I
nitial revisi
o
n
commit
|
commitdiff
|
tree